Bank Rakyat offers a moratorium of up to six months for flood victims in Sabah

KUALA LUMPUR: Bank Rakyat offers special flood assistance, including a moratorium facility of up to six months, to individual and business customers affected by the flood disaster in Sabah.

This includes the districts of Penampang, Putatan, Tuaran, and Tamparuli.

In a statement today, CEO of Bank Rakyat, Dato’ Dr. Mohammad Hanis Osman, said that as a caring Islamic financial institution, Bank Rakyat is committed to reducing the burdens and difficulties faced by its customers and hopes that this moratorium facility will provide relief to those affected.

“This proactive step taken by Bank Rakyat, which is in line with the values of concern and generosity in the concept of Malaysia Madani, aims to reduce the financial burdens and commitments borne by customers during these challenging times.

“Therefore, customers facing difficulties in making installment payments for subscribed products can apply for this moratorium assistance.

“This includes products such as Personal Financing-i, Home Financing-i, Vehicle Financing-i, Vehicle Lease Financing-i, Education Financing-i, Micro Financing-i, and Pawn Financing-i,” said Dato’ Dr. Mohammad Hanis.
